Milestones

2019

  • Aug – ComfortRIDE crosses two-million mark.
  • May – ComfortDelGro Taxi launches ComfortRIDE, a new booking service whose fares adjusts according to market supply and demand.
  • Jan – Trial of fully electric taxi expanded to include long range Hyundai Kona electric taxis that boasts battery power twice that of the Ioniq.

2018

  • Jul – ComfortDelGro Taxi trials first fast-charging fully-electric Hyundai Ioniq taxis in Singapore.
  • Jan – ComfortDelGro Taxi and Uber launched UberFLASH service in Uber App.

2017

  • Dec – ComforDelGro and Uber announce their alliance.
  • Jul – ComfortDelGro Taxi the first in Asia to extend masterpass payments to street hail.
  • Jun – Launch of CabRewards+ Programme which rewards commuters who travel on bus, trains and taxi.
  • Apr – ComfortDelGro Taxi offers flat fare option for the first time and clocks 100,000 flat fare jobs in 10 days.

2015

  • Aug – Named Best Taxi Agency and Best Taxi App by TripAdvisor for the second year.
  • May – First taxi company in Southeast Asia to launch the Euro 6 BlueTEC Mercedes LimoCabs.

2014

  • Jun – Named Best Taxi Agency and Best Taxi App by TripAdvisor at its Travellers’ Choice Awards for the first time.

2013

  • Dec – In-vehicle cameras was installed in all ComfortDelGro taxis.

2012

  • Sep – Euro 5 LimoCabs and MaxiCabs were rolled out.

2010

  • Feb – ComfortDelGro App was launched.

2009

  • Sep – Online taxi booking was introduced.

2007

  • Jan – ComfortDelGro Hyundai Sonata taxis were rolled out.

2006

  • Nov – NETS payment was made available for the first time in taxis in Singapore.

2003

  • Apr – Merger of Comfort Group Ltd and DelGro Corporation Limited to form ComfortDelGro Corporation Limited. Comfort Transportation and CityCab became subsidiaries of ComfortDelGro.

2001

  • Sep – Newly-improved bi-coloured Light Emitting Diode (LED) rooftop signage and talking MDTs made their debut.
  • Mar – Comfort rolled out three-litre Toyota Crown taxis.

2000

  • Nov – Commemoration of Comfort’s 30th Anniversary with the launch of the new logo and livery. It also started its cashless payment systems.

1998

  • Apr – CityCab introduced MaxiCab, a 7-seater cab.

1995

  • Jul – CityCab Pte Ltd commenced operations on 1 July 1995 after the merger of 3 taxi companies – Singapore Airport Bus Service Ltd (SABS), Singapore Bus Service Taxi Pte Ltd (SBS Taxi Pte Ltd) and Singapore Commuter Pte Ltd.

1993

  • Jun – NTUC Comfort was corporatised and renamed Comfort Transportation Pte Ltd.

1986

  • Apr – Launch of Comfort’s Core Skills for Effectiveness and Change Training Scheme (COSEC) to equip members with skills to provide better service.

1981

  • Jun – Electronic meters were introduced.

1977

  • Feb – Comfort set up home at Sin Ming Drive.

1971

  • Jan – The first 1,000 Comfort Morris Oxford taxis and 196 minibuses hit the roads.

1970

  • Oct – Formation of the NTUC Workers’ Co-operative Commonwealth for Transport.
